Biography

Tony Osoba is a Scottish actor. Born in Glasgow in 1947, he trained at the Royal Scottish Academy of Music and Drama. His breakthrough role was as Jim 'Jock' McLaren in the BBC sitcom Porridge (1974–1977).

Osoba has appeared in numerous television series including Dempsey and Makepeace (1985–1986) as Det. Sgt. Chas Jarvis, two roles in Coronation Street (1982 and 1990), and episodes of Doctor Who across multiple series. He has also worked in theatre, including productions with the Royal Shakespeare Company, and in films such as the 1979 adaptation of Porridge.
